A luxury fashion house is looking for a passionate Full-Time Sales Associate to join their Selfridges concession in London. The ideal candidate will have a deep knowledge of accessories and leather goods, excellent communication skills, and a passion for fashion.

Responsibilities include:

  • Providing exceptional customer service
  • Building strong customer relationships
  • Achieving sales targets

Flexibility in working hours is required, and candidates must have the right to work in the UK.

How to prepare for a job interview at Christian Dior S.A.

Know Your Fashion

Brush up on your knowledge of luxury accessories and leather goods. Be prepared to discuss current trends, iconic pieces, and the brand's history. This shows your passion for fashion and helps you connect with the interviewers.

Showcase Your Communication Skills

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. Role-play common customer scenarios to demonstrate how you would provide exceptional service. Remember, they want to see how you build relationships with customers!

Flexibility is Key

Be ready to discuss your availability and willingness to work flexible hours. Highlight any previous experience where you adapted to changing schedules or demands, as this is crucial in a retail environment.

Set Sales Goals

Prepare to talk about your approach to achieving sales targets. Share specific examples from past roles where you exceeded expectations, and be ready to discuss strategies you would use to drive sales in their store.
